James Elderfield is a Lead Game Programmer based in Helsinki with 11 years of engineering experience that spans game development, product engineering, DevOps and computational biology. He combines a PhD in Mathematical and Computational Biology from Cambridge with hands-on systems design—building product features, CI/CD pipelines and test automation across startups and scaleups. James has led and grown engineering teams as CTO/Tech Lead, restructured organisations for domain-focused delivery, and driven migrations such as JS→TypeScript and monorepo architectures. Comfortable as both an individual contributor and manager, he routinely ships end-to-end products from user research to production. Unusually for a senior engineer, his background in academic modelling informs pragmatic approaches to complex system design and tooling. Currently shaping games at Next Games after recent product work in clinical and data tooling, he blends scientific thinking with product-first software craft.
